Output e12312255df2cb505e6b9d24c918432ba71cf6fa36734009a6f9bc9b68868a2d:1

value
864633006
script pubkey
OP_0 OP_PUSHBYTES_20 2ac5ae7c034097bbf377a6dbce62ca263cf789a4
address
ltc1q9tz6ulqrgztmhumh5mduuck2yc700zdy7lujdd
transaction
e12312255df2cb505e6b9d24c918432ba71cf6fa36734009a6f9bc9b68868a2d
spent
true